An immaculate one bedroom apartment with direct canal views.
Description
Designed with both style and functionality in mind, this home features a thoughtfully arranged open-plan living area, where a sleek, integrated kitchen sits just to the side. Upgraded with elegant quartz worktops, Bosch appliances, and a dedicated breakfast bar, the kitchen also benefits from additional prep space and a 12-bottle under-counter wine fridge—ideal for those who enjoy cooking and entertaining.
The expansive reception area offers ample room to relax and unwind, with direct access to a south-facing private balcony overlooking the tranquil canal.
The bedroom is well-proportioned, furnished with a double bed and enhanced by a bespoke fitted wardrobe, while custom shelving throughout the flat adds practical, stylish storage solutions. The three piece bathroom suite can be located off the hallway.
As a final touch, a water softener system has been installed to protect plumbing and appliances—helping to keep your home running smoothly and spotlessly clean.
Location
Experience unparalleled convenience with swift access to the heart of Canary Wharf's esteemed business district. Whether you prefer a leisurely 20-minute walk or a quick 3-minute DLR ride from Westferry Station, you'll find yourself at the epicentre of London’s financial hub in no time. Westferry DLR Station is situated approximately 0.6 miles from the property and offers exceptional connections to key destinations, including Bank, Stratford International, London City Airport, and the Royal Greenwich Peninsula. For further connectivity, Mile End Tube Station is also just a 20-minute stroll away, while an array of local bus services will effortlessly take you to Oxford Circus, Trafalgar Square, Bethnal Green, Hackney, and the vibrant Isle of Dogs and Canary Wharf.
Beyond the professional allure of Canary Wharf, residents can enjoy the surrounding area's thriving social scene. From contemporary dockside dining and atmospheric pubs to a curated selection of cultural attractions, including galleries, cinemas, and premier hotels, there is something for every taste and occasion.
